How to Make Cayenne Pepper Sauce – The Recipe Method

  1. First, gather up your cayenne peppers.
  2. Chop up the cayenne peppers along with garlic cloves and add them to a pot with white wine vinegar and a bit of salt.
  3. Bring the mix to a boil, then reduce the heat to low and simmer everything for 20 minutes.

What can I use in place of cayenne pepper sauce?

Hot Sauce. A few dashes of hot sauce are a good substitute for cayenne. The best hot sauce is a Louisiana Style Hot Sauce, such as Tabasco or Crystal hot sauce, but if you can find a non-vinegar based hot sauce, that would be even better.

Is cayenne pepper the same as chili powder?

Ground cayenne pepper is technically a chili powder, but jars and bottles labeled “chili powder” are usually made from a blend of a variety of peppers. Most chili powders you find in stores also include spices like cumin, onion and garlic powder, and salt.

What is the difference between cayenne pepper and paprika?

Cayenne is earthy and spicy, whereas paprika can range from earthy and spicy to mild and sweet. It may be best to cut the amount of chili powder that a recipe is requiring if you are opting for cayenne over paprika. Otherwise, the dish may be a little too hot for those used to milder spices.

Why are my cayenne peppers green?

Growing. Cayenne peppers grow best in hot temperatures with full sun. The plants prefer moist, well-drained soil and grow 12 to 24 inches tall. Cayenne pepper plants have bright green leaves and produce bounties of green peppers that turn red when ripe.

Is cayenne pepper spicy?

How spicy is cayenne pepper? Cayenne pepper is relatively mild compared to the world’s hottest chili. It is a medium hot chili with a Scoville rating of 30,000 to 50,000 heat units, nestled between serrano peppers and the Thai pepper. When using jalapeño as a reference point, it is about 12 times hotter.
